Questions about inflammatory diseases
Does targeting ISG15 help with skin inflammatory diseases?
Targeting the ISG15 pathway shows potential for treating skin inflammatory diseases because ISG15 can act as a cytokine that worsens inflammation, but current research is mostly theoretical.
